Abstract

A device and method for the detection of one or more gases is disclosed.A MEMS structure comprising a micro gas cell array is provided comprising one or more micro gas cells having a predetermined gas therein. The micro gas cells define an optical path therethrough and may comprise a micro lens. Electromagnetic energy from a scene is collected and passed through one or more micro gas cells whereby electromagnetic energy emitted or reflected from a gas of interest in a scene is absorbed by a substantially identical gas contained within a micro gas cell. In this manner, the micro gas cell acts as a spectral filter.The electromagnetic outputs of the micro gas cells, which may comprise one or more spectrally inert micro gas cells, are received by one or more detector elements such as a photon detector array. The ratio of the outputs of the related detector elements are computed by processing electronics, resulting in the identification of the gas of interest.
